Back to newsChania is hosting the 10th annual SouthBreak Jam this Saturday at the Mikis Theodorakis Theatre. One of Greece's most significant dance events, the festival brings together 100 dancers specializing in Breakdance and Streetdance from 16 different regions. The anniversary edition marks a decade of the event drawing competitors and spectators to western Crete.
